Workplace Personality Project

The Workplace Personality Project (WPP) is dedicated to advancing education and science of understanding organizational behavior with an emphasis on the role of personality.

The primary goal of the Workplace Personality Project is to aid in the scientific education of students examining organizational behavior. This will be accomplished by providing students with opportunities to work first hand with local organizations and through support for research projects and conference attendance. Scientific information obtained through support from the Workplace Personality Project will be published in a form available to the interested public. A secondary goal is to aid the Melbourne community and wider Florida area by encouraging the development of local government and industry through the application of scientific principles of organizational behavior. Such practices include, but are not limited to: job analysis, recruitment, employee assessment, performance appraisal, performance management, and organizational training.
